Contract Killing and then a miscalculation leading to a second death - these were what tied an abandoned car found near Mumbai and two missing property dealers, the Maharashtra Police have found. The men in question - property dealers Aamir Khanzada and Sumit Jain - have been missing since August 21. But the police had no clue till the Baleno car was found near Mumbai Pune Expressway two days later.
Deepak Sakore, a senior police officer of Navi Mumbai, said the they found bullet marks, two empty cartridges and blood inside the car.
The breakthrough came when they arrested Vitthal Nakade, who was linked to the contract killer.
